Diagnostic Medical Sonographer Salary in Winston-Salem, NC: $90,816 (2026)

Quick Answer:A full-time diagnostic medical sonographer in Winston-Salem, NC earns a median $90,816/year (≈ $43.66/hour) in nominal terms for 2026 — projected from BLS OEWS 2025 (SOC 29-2032). Once you factor in Winston-Salem's price level (6% below national, BEA RPP 93.6), that paycheck buys what $97,026 would nationally. Nominal pay sits 3.6% above the North Carolina state average.

Based on 7 years of BLS OEWS data for the Winston-Salem metropolitan area, the median diagnostic medical sonographer salary grew 30.0% from $66,594 (2019) to $86,549 (2025). At a 4.93% compound annual growth rate, salaries are projected to reach $95,293 by 2027 — a total increase of $28,699 (43.10%) from 2019.

Diagnostic Medical Sonographer Job Market in Winston-Salem

With 59 diagnostic medical sonographers currently employed in the Winston-Salem area, the local job market shows solid stability despite variations in compensation. The cost-of-living index stands at 93.6, suggesting that salaries provide reasonable purchasing power compared to national standards. Hospitals generally offer the highest salaries, followed closely by outpatient imaging centers such as RadNet and SimonMed, while practices specializing in cardiac care tend to pay more than those focused on OB-GYN. Factors influencing pay disparity include specialty areas, with cardiac sonographers earning top-tier wages, and additional incentives for roles that require on-call shift work or supervisory responsibilities. To maximize earning potential, pursuing advanced ARDMS credentials, particularly in cardiac and vascular specialties, along with seeking employment in hospitals or high-demand outpatient settings, can significantly enhance diagnostic medical sonographer pay in Winston-Salem, NC.
